  2. Cannondale -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cannondale

    Cannondale has brought a few concepts to market that have since become accepted industry standards. Cannondale was the first to produce a crankset that uses externally mounted bottom bracket bearings, though they later discontinued this design. External bearings are now the most common type of bottom bracket for mid-level and higher bicycles.

  3. Bike shop -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Bike_shop

    Beyond bicycles, a bike shop may offer clothing and other accessories, spare and replacement parts, tools, and a variety of services. [3]Services may include expert fitting and custom bike building or ordering, [4] maintenance and repairs from experienced bicycle mechanics, and organized group rides and classes. [5]

  4. Wilton, Connecticut -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Wilton,_Connecticut

    The town has two railroad stations: Wilton near the town center and Cannondale. Both are served by Metro-North Railroad's Danbury Branch, which provides direct commuter train service south to Norwalk (15 minutes), Stamford (25 minutes), and New York City's Grand Central Terminal (90 minutes); and north to Danbury (33 minutes).

  5. Schwinn Bicycle Company -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Schwinn_Bicycle_Company

    The Schwinn Bicycle Company is an American company that develops, manufactures and markets bicycles under the eponymous brand name. The company was founded by Ignaz Schwinn (1860–1948) in Chicago in 1895, [2] [3] and in the 20th century became the dominant manufacturer of American bicycles.
